1966 Jensen FF vs. 1966 Skoda 1202
To start off, both 1966 Jensen FF and 1966 Skoda 1202 were released in the same year (1966). Therefore the support and the availability on parts for both vehicles should be relatively similar. At 6,276 cc (8 cylinders), 1966 Jensen FF is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1966 Jensen FF (279 HP @ 4600 RPM) has 235 more horse power than 1966 Skoda 1202. (44 HP @ 4200 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 1966 Jensen FF should accelerate faster than 1966 Skoda 1202.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1966 Jensen FF weights approximately 870 kg more than 1966 Skoda 1202.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Let's talk about torque, 1966 Jensen FF (588 Nm @ 2800 RPM) has 504 more torque (in Nm) than 1966 Skoda 1202. (84 Nm @ 2500 RPM). This means 1966 Jensen FF will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1966 Skoda 1202.
